Palestro\u003cbr\u003e • Publisher: Springer\u003cbr\u003e • Publisher Imprint: Springer\u003cbr\u003e • BISAC: Cognitive Psychology \u0026amp; Cognition\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This book explains the foundation of approximate Bayesian computation (ABC), an approach to Bayesian inference that does not require the specification of a likelihood function. As a result, ABC can be used to estimate posterior distributions of parameters for simulation-based models. Simulation-based models are now very popular in cognitive science, as are Bayesian methods for performing parameter inference. As such, the recent developments of likelihood-free techniques are an important advancement for the field.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eChapters discuss the philosophy of Bayesian inference as well as provide several algorithms for performing ABC. Chapters also apply some of the algorithms in a tutorial fashion, with one specific application to the Minerva 2 model. In addition, the book discusses several applications of ABC methodology to recent problems in cognitive science.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e\u003ci\u003eLikelihood-Free Methods for Cognitive Science \u003c\/i\u003ewill be of interest to researchers and graduate students working in experimental, applied, and cognitive science. \u003c\/p\u003e\u003cbr\u003e","brand":"Springer","offers":[{"title":"Hardcover","offer_id":45281633665175,"sku":"9783319724249","price":3639.0,"currency_code":"INR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0666\/3471\/1191\/files\/9783319724249.webp?v=1769299791","url":"https:\/\/atlanticbooks.com\/products\/likelihood-free-methods-for-cognitive-science-9783319724249","provider":"Atlantic Books","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
